The Smart Buddie booster pump is quiet, easy to install, and can significantly increase water output. Reverse osmosis is a pressure-driven process. Small residential RO units will theoretically operate on very low pressure--down to 35 psi--but the reality is you won't get a lot of water and the product water quality may be compromised if the unit runs below 45 psi. RO units typically run well on municipal water pressure of 60 psi, but they run even better with a small pump to boost the pressure to 80 psi or higher. The increased pressure will also improve the economy of the unit (it will run less reject water) as well as the quality of the water. RO units thrive on pressure!

Features:

  • The high pressure switch turns off the booster pump if the filtered water pressure is greater than 33.35 PSI, prolonging the life of the pump.
  • Buddie Fit press-fittings make it easy to plumb tubing into the existing RO system.
  • The sealed pressure pump is low-voltage and powered by the included transformer, which ensures safe, quiet operation.
  • Easily plumb into most reverse osmosis systems to increase water pressure up to 90 PSI and reduce waste water.
  • The Smart Buddie Booster Pump includes an internal automatic flush valve that flushes the membrane for 18 seconds every time the unit is activated. Flushing clears debris build-up on the membrane, and is critical to obtaining peak performance from the RO unit. After flushing filtered water production will begin.
  • Low pressure switch turns off the booster pump if water pressure is less than 7.25 PSI, extending the life of the pump.
